A court challenge by Michael Jarjura will tie up Kevin Lembo’s public financing for least another day in the race for the Democratic nomination for comptroller.

Superior Court Judge James T. Graham adjourned at 6 p.m. today without concluding a hearing into Jarjura’s complaint that the State Elections Enforcement Commission improperly granted Lembo $375,000 in public financing.

The hearing will resume at 10 a.m. Tuesday in Hartford Superior Court.

Jarjura, the mayor of Waterbury, is challenging Lembo, who won the endorsement of the Democratic State Convention in May.
